The Bose TV Speaker is an affordable soundbar designed to enhance your TV's audio in a simple and effective way. Its compact size (just over 2 inches tall) allows for easy placement in front of your TV or wall mounting, making it a versatile option for various setups. This soundbar features 2 angled full-range drivers that provide a wide and natural sound, which helps create a more immersive and realistic audio experience for your TV shows and movies.

Additionally, it is particularly good at elevating and clarifying dialogue, which is beneficial for those who have trouble hearing speech clearly on their TV speakers. The soundbar comes with Bluetooth connectivity, allowing you to wirelessly stream music and podcasts from your devices. The setup is user-friendly, requiring just one connection through either an optical audio cable (included) or an HDMI cable (sold separately). The included remote control offers convenient access to a dialogue mode for enhanced speech clarity and a bass boost mode for added depth in the audio.

Despite its strengths, the Bose TV Speaker does have some limitations. It does not come with a built-in subwoofer, although it is compatible with the Bose Bass Module 500 or 700, which are sold separately. This means that while the soundbar itself provides improved audio over standard TV speakers, it may lack the deep bass that some users might desire without additional investment. The connectivity options include Bluetooth, HDMI ARC, Optical in, and AUX in, but it lacks more advanced features like Wi-Fi connectivity or smart assistant integration. The Bose TV Speaker is a solid choice for those looking for an affordable and straightforward soundbar that enhances TV audio with clear dialogue and natural sound, though it may require additional components for users seeking enhanced bass performance.

The Sony S100F 2.0ch Soundbar is a solid choice for anyone looking to enhance their home audio experience without breaking the bank. With features like a built-in tweeter and Bass Reflex speaker, it delivers a deep and clear sound, making it suitable for TV shows, movies, and even conference calls. One of its standout qualities is the voice enhancement feature, which helps in situations where dialogue can be hard to hear, a real bonus for people who often watch TV or hold meetings at home.

The soundbar is compact and designed to fit nicely in small spaces, which is a great advantage if you have limited room. Its HDMI ARC connectivity simplifies the setup with your TV, and the Bluetooth option allows for wireless audio streaming from various devices—so you can easily enjoy music from your phone or tablet.

There are a few trade-offs to consider. The S100F doesn’t come with a separate subwoofer, which means it might not deliver the same level of bass you would find in higher-end models. Additionally, while it has a surround sound mode, it is limited to a 2.0 channel configuration, which might not satisfy users looking for a more immersive audio experience. The soundbar is wall-mountable, making it versatile for different setups, but keep in mind that it may not perform as well in larger rooms compared to more powerful alternatives. Also, while it includes a remote for easy control, the reliance on two AA batteries can be a minor inconvenience. The Sony S100F is an affordable option for those who want a straightforward soundbar for home entertainment or office use, but it might not fulfill the needs of audiophiles or those seeking heavy bass performance.

The Roku Streambar SE is an affordable 2-in-1 soundbar that offers both sound enhancement and built-in streaming capabilities for smaller TVs. It features two premium speakers and a dedicated bass port, delivering surprisingly big sound with enhanced speech clarity, which is great for hearing dialogue more clearly without the need for closed captions. The soundbar supports 4K HDR streaming and has built-in apps like Netflix, Prime Video, Hulu, and YouTube, ensuring a seamless streaming experience.

Connectivity options include Bluetooth, Wi-Fi, optical cable, and HDMI, which offer flexibility in how you connect it to your TV and other devices. Moreover, the Streambar SE comes with a simple remote that can control both the TV and the soundbar, reducing the need to juggle multiple remotes. The automatic volume control feature adjusts the volume for clear voices and lower commercials automatically. Additionally, it supports wireless headphones for private listening and can be expanded with the Roku Wireless Bass subwoofer for richer sound.

However, it lacks compatibility with Roku Wireless Speakers and might not provide the full surround sound experience some users might expect. With its compact design (9.6 x 3.5 x 2.4 inches) and easy setup, it's an excellent choice for smaller spaces like bedrooms. The product is lightweight at 2 pounds, making it a dependable and user-friendly option for those seeking to upgrade their TV audio and streaming capabilities without breaking the bank.

Buying Guide for the Best Affordable Sound Bars

Choosing the right sound bar can significantly enhance your audio experience, whether you're watching movies, playing games, or listening to music. When selecting an affordable sound bar, it's important to consider several key specifications to ensure you get the best value for your money. Understanding these specs will help you make an informed decision that matches your needs and preferences.
Audio ChannelsAudio channels refer to the number of separate audio tracks that a sound bar can produce. Common configurations include 2.0, 2.1, 3.1, and 5.1 channels. A 2.0 channel sound bar has two speakers (left and right), while a 2.1 channel adds a subwoofer for enhanced bass. A 3.1 channel includes a center speaker for clearer dialogue, and a 5.1 channel adds rear speakers for a surround sound experience. If you primarily watch TV shows and movies, a 3.1 or 5.1 channel sound bar can provide a more immersive experience. For casual listening or smaller spaces, a 2.0 or 2.1 channel may suffice.
Connectivity OptionsConnectivity options determine how you can connect your sound bar to other devices. Common options include HDMI ARC, optical input, Bluetooth, and AUX. HDMI ARC allows for high-quality audio and easy control with your TV remote. Optical input also provides good audio quality but requires a separate remote. Bluetooth is convenient for wireless streaming from smartphones and tablets, while AUX is a simple wired connection. Consider your primary use case: if you want to connect multiple devices or stream wirelessly, look for a sound bar with versatile connectivity options.
Power OutputPower output, measured in watts, indicates the sound bar's loudness and overall audio performance. Higher wattage generally means louder and clearer sound. For small to medium-sized rooms, a sound bar with 100-200 watts should be sufficient. For larger spaces or if you prefer louder audio, look for a sound bar with 200 watts or more. Your listening habits and room size will guide you in choosing the right power output.
SubwooferA subwoofer enhances the bass frequencies, adding depth and richness to the audio. Some sound bars come with a built-in subwoofer, while others include a separate, often wireless, subwoofer. If you enjoy bass-heavy music, action movies, or gaming, a sound bar with a dedicated subwoofer can significantly improve your experience. For general TV watching or if space is limited, a built-in subwoofer may be adequate.
Sound ModesSound modes are preset audio settings that optimize the sound bar's performance for different types of content, such as movies, music, news, or sports. These modes adjust the audio balance to enhance dialogue clarity, bass, or overall sound quality. If you watch a variety of content, look for a sound bar with multiple sound modes to easily switch between settings and get the best audio experience for each type of content.
Size and DesignThe size and design of the sound bar should complement your TV and fit well in your living space. Sound bars come in various lengths and styles, from compact models to larger, more elaborate designs. Measure the space where you plan to place the sound bar and ensure it won't block your TV screen or interfere with other devices. Additionally, consider the aesthetic appeal and how it matches your home decor. A well-designed sound bar can enhance both your audio experience and the overall look of your entertainment setup.
